Best Schools in 71232, LA
71232, LA has a total of 11 schools including 3 high schools, 4 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 4,046 students attend 71232, LA schools. On average, schools in 71232 score 10%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 16%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in 71232 underperform exp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 71232, LA
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
71232, LA has a total population of 5,969 with 20%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 77%, and 12%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
